Gain characters of CuⅡ laser oscillation studied with rad ation measurement

  • 1. East China Institute of Technology;
  • 2. Institute of Laser, Huazhong University of Science and Technology

Abstract: The laser osillation of Cu Ⅱ 740.4nm(6SD3-5P3P230)line is obtained with the full metal copper hollow cathode laser designed by the authors.To study optimum condition of laser operation,gain characteristic of the line is measured with radiation measurement under a variety of exciting condition.Measuring results are discussed.The authors come to the conclusion that gain of CuⅡ740.4nm is maximum when He:Ar equals 4:1 in the case of He-Ar-Cu discharge.The conclusion is in good agree with practical laser output characteristic.
